Renin Substrate 1 is widely utilized in research focused on
- Cardiovascular Research: This compound is essential for studying the renin-angiotensin system, which plays a critical role in blood pressure regulation and cardiovascular health.
- Drug Development: It serves as a valuable tool in the development of antihypertensive medications, allowing researchers to evaluate the efficacy of new treatments targeting the renin pathway.
- Biochemical Assays: Renin Substrate 1 is used in various assays to measure renin activity, helping researchers understand its role in various physiological and pathological conditions.
- Endocrinology Studies: This compound aids in the exploration of hormonal regulation and its effects on kidney function and fluid balance, providing insights into disorders like hypertension and heart failure.
- Comparative Studies: It allows for comparisons between different substrates and inhibitors, helping to identify more effective therapeutic strategies in managing diseases related to the renin-angiotensin system.
